Kirsty Williams welcomes lottery grants
12.51.00pm UTC (GMT +0000) Mon 3rd Apr 2006
Welsh Liberal Democrat AM for Brecon and Radnorshire, Kirsty Williams, has congratulated three churches in the constituency on being awarded Heritage Lottery Fund grants.
St Stephen's Church in Old Radnor, and St Michael and All Angels and St Michael's, both near Presteigne, will all receive grant money.
Ms Williams said: "I am delighted to see that these historic buildings are to receive some help and recognition. The preservation of our heritage is vitally important for the education of future generations and for the development of our tourist industry, which is so important to the Welsh economy. As places of worship, these churches also provide a valued service to local people, and this award will assist them in the important work that they do in the community."
Notes:
A grant of £71,000 has been set aside for St Stephen's Church, which will be made available once further work on the application has been satisfactorily completed. A development grant of £19,200 has been awarded to support this further work.
A grant of £43,000 has been set aside for St Michael and All Angels Church, which will be made available once further work on the application has been satisfactorily completed. A development grant of £13,200 has been awarded to support this further work.
A grant of £51,800 has been set aside for St Michael's Church, which will be made available once further work on the application has been satisfactorily completed. A development grant of £6,100 has been awarded to support this further work.
